Aggiornare il BIOS è già un rischio, da Ubuntu ancora di più.

Questo perchè l'eseguibile per aggiornare un BIOS è sempre un .exe quindi hai bisogno di un live ms-dos (cd, usb, floppy) con al suo interno eseguibile e nuovo firmware.

Io l'ho fatto varie volte su vari desktop sempre da floppy con un floppy avviabile (credo) di win98 (non ricordo più).
